WebApr 12, 2024 · May lower the interest rate on the loan. Timely repayments can help build a good credit history. Cons: Cosigning a loan means you are responsible for the payments if the borrower cannot make them. If the borrower defaults on the loan, it will bring down the cosigner’s credit score drastically. A cosigner is basically someone who backs the loan. They sign agreeing that if you don’t make the payments as promised, they will step in to pay them. If you don’t have much of a credit history or your credit is bad or poor, lenders are typically hesitant to give you an auto loan. They perceive you as risky. WebJun 6, 2024 · The benefits to the borrower. A cosigner might help: Get a reduced security deposit on an apartment lease. Get a lower interest rate and lower monthly payment on a loan for a car. Secure a mortgage with a lower interest rate. Get a private student loan with a lower interest rate. Having a cosigner is helpful to the borrower.
